Deadwood had a population of nearly 3,000 people September 30, 1876.

Deadwood's first sheriff was Isac Brown. He was elected Miner's Court sheriff over the Jack McCall trial Aug 05, 1876. Isac Brown would later be killed by Indians on August 20th along with Preacher Smith and others. Con Stapleton secured the next marshal's seat on September 16, 1876.

Cheyenne was the logical �jumping-off� place for stage and freight lines wanting to service the Black Hills when the time came. Jack Gilmer was one of the first operators to consider the possibility of a stage line from Cheyenne to the Black Hills; however, his line was not the first to serve the hills, that was left to Cuthberson and Young and Yates and Brown. To make a long story short, Gilmer bought out Yates & Brown in 1876 and formed what became known as the Cheyenne & Black Hills Stage Line, known to both history and motion picture buffs as the �Deadwood Stage.� The Deadwood Stage carried gold bullion from Deadwood, S.D., to Cheyenne, Wyo

Wild Bill Hickok's death August 5, 1873 triggered a demand for more law and order in the Dakota territory, and resulted in Seth Bullock's appointment as the first Sheriff of Deadwood. He quickly appointed several able, fearless deputies and before long order had settled upon Deadwood. During 1884, Bullock then became a deputy U. S. Marshal in western Dakota Territory.
